Overview

Extracellular proteins encompass a vast and heterogeneous group of proteins located outside the plasma membrane, including those secreted into bodily fluids and those constituting the extracellular matrix (ECM) (UniProt, 2024). They serve critical roles in maintaining tissue architecture, providing mechanical support, and facilitating intercellular communication through signaling molecules such as cytokines, growth factors, and hormones (NIH, 2023). While many specific members of this class—such as Vascular Endothelial Growth Factor (VEGF) or Tumor Necrosis Factor (TNF)—are pivotal therapeutic targets, the term 'Extracellular protein' itself is a general classification rather than a single target (Alberts et al., 'Molecular Biology of the Cell'). Dysregulation of these proteins is a hallmark of various pathologies, including cancer metastasis, where the ECM is remodeled, and chronic inflammatory diseases driven by secreted pro-inflammatory mediators (PubMed, 2022). In pharmacology, these proteins are frequently targeted by monoclonal antibodies designed to sequester ligands or block their interaction with cell-surface receptors. Because the term describes a subcellular location and functional state rather than a specific molecular entity, it does not possess a singular pharmacological profile or a unified set of interacting drugs.

Mechanism of action

As a broad category, there is no single mechanism of action; specific proteins within this class are targeted by neutralizing antibodies, decoy receptors, or enzyme inhibitors.
